Inmate found after walking away from Beckley work-release center

BECKLEY, W.Va. -- Police located an inmate who had walked away from a Beckley work-release center Wednesday.

George Henderson IV, 26, of Nitro, did not return to the Beckley Correctional Center after leaving for work early Wednesday morning. He was supposed to return to the center in the afternoon, according to Raleigh County sheriff's dispatchers.

Around 6 p.m., Henderson was found near the Beckley Plaza shopping center, according to an officer at the correctional center.

Henderson is serving a sentence on narcotic manufacturing and conspiracy to deliver charges in Kanawha County. He'll now be moved to a more secure facility, according to police.
